Handover note for the release manager — PickPath Optimizer

Before cutting release 4.2 of PickPath, the pick-list optimizer used at the Thornvale fulfillment site, please note the following. The routing weights were retuned last sprint; regression results are attached and within tolerance. The canary rollout should stay at 10% for 48 hours. All deployment configs are sealed in the Harborline vault, and the unseal step is required before the first build. The vault's recovery passphrase is given below.

unlock words, hafop-tahog: drumir-druiel-kasox-wenax-tamys-frair

TilePloy is our map-tile prefetcher; it warms regional caches ahead of forecasted demand. We run three environments: dev (single node, synthetic traffic), staging (mirrors production topology at reduced scale), and production (multi-region, autoscaled). Please note that staging shares the tile store with production but writes to a shadow namespace, so never point a load test at staging without clearing it with the Harrowgate team first. Each environment reads its settings at boot; production currently uses the following values.

config for kafof-bawef:
holath:
  log_level: debug
  metrics_host: metrics.holath.qorvelsys.internal
  pin: 2191
  pool_size: 32

Action item PM-2291 (Lanternjet incident, queue-depth autoscaler): the scaler flapped because scale-down triggered before backlog fully drained, causing repeated cold starts visible to customers as slow ticket ingestion. Support should know the scaler now uses a longer cooldown and a hysteresis band, so brief backlog spikes no longer add workers. If customers report lag, check depth against these thresholds first. The revised constants are below.

constants for bawif-kawif:
QUOTAS = {
    "ulaael": 5,
    "holael": 10,
}

## Rendering pipeline basics

Welcome aboard! Our markdown rendering pipeline, Inkmill, takes raw docs, runs them through the sanitizer, then the Quillpress renderer, and finally caches the HTML in the Fernbrook store. Most of your early tickets will be about weird table edge cases — don't panic, there's a fixture library for that. To push a rendered bundle to staging you'll sign it locally first, and the key everyone on the team uses is this one.

deploy key for kajof-fajop: bky6_gDHw9Q